Understanding the Four Seasons of Real Estate
To effectively navigate real estate market cycles for maximum returns, you must first recognize the four distinct phases that property markets consistently experience. Think of them as the four seasons:
-
Recovery: The quiet period after a downturn. Characterized by low prices, high vacancy, and cautious optimism.
-
Expansion: The boom. Prices rise steadily, construction accelerates, and confidence is high.
-
Hyper-Supply: The peak. Supply begins to outpace demand, prices stagnate, and the market feels overheated.
-
Recession: The correction. Prices decline, vacancies rise, and pessimism prevails.
Your strategy must adapt to each season to successfully navigate real estate market cycles for maximum returns.
Phase 1: Recovery – The Strategic Acquisition Window
This is arguably the most crucial phase for those learning how to navigate real estate market cycles for maximum returns. The recovery phase is defined by fear and uncertainty, which creates unique opportunities for the bold.
-
Your Mindset: Be a contrarian. While others are fearful, you should be gathering resources and conducting diligent research.
-
Actionable Strategy: This is the prime time for buying. Focus on acquiring quality assets—well-located properties with strong fundamentals—at discounted prices. Look for motivated sellers and properties that need minor work (value-add opportunities) that others are overlooking.
-
Key Metric to Watch: Look for stabilizing or slightly declining vacancy rates, which signal the bottom of the market is near.

Phase 2: Expansion – The Growth and Hold Strategy
During the expansion phase, the market’s upward trend becomes clear. Your goal shifts from aggressive acquisition to capitalizing on the growth.
-
Your Mindset: Be disciplined. Avoid getting caught in bidding wars and overpaying out of FOMO (Fear Of Missing Out).
-
Actionable Strategy: This is the time to hold and improve. Property values are appreciating naturally. Focus on paying down debt, making strategic renovations to increase rental income, and solidifying your financial position. It is generally not the time for aggressive new purchases, as prices are at their highest.
-
Key Metric to Watch: Monitor the pace of new construction; a rapid increase can signal the approaching hyper-supply phase.
Phase 3: Hyper-Supply – The Preparation Phase
The market feels euphoric, but the smart investor is preparing for a shift. Knowing how to navigate real estate market cycles for maximum returns means recognizing when to take your foot off the gas.
-
Your Mindset: Be cautious and analytical. The easy money has been made.
-
Actionable Strategy: This is the time to consider selling non-core assets. If you have properties that have appreciated significantly, liquidating them can lock in profits and build a cash war chest for the next recovery. Avoid new development projects and focus on strengthening the cash flow of your existing portfolio.
-
Key Metric to Watch: Rising inventory levels and a slowdown in the rate of price appreciation are clear warning signs.
Phase 4: Recession – The Defense and Opportunity Scan
When the market corrects, your primary goal is to protect your assets while scanning for the next opportunity. This is the ultimate test of your ability to navigate real estate market cycles for maximum returns.
-
Your Mindset: Be patient and defensive. Preserve capital.
-
Actionable Strategy: Tighten your operations. Focus on retaining good tenants, managing cash flow meticulously, and avoiding unnecessary risks. Use this time to conduct deep market research, build relationships with lenders, and identify the asset classes and locations that will lead the next recovery. The seeds of the next fortune are planted in this phase.
-
Key Metric to Watch: Look for a peak in vacancy rates and a stabilization in the rate of price decline, indicating the market is finding its bottom.

The Golden Thread: Cash Flow is King
No matter the phase, one principle remains constant and is essential to navigate real estate market cycles for maximum returns: the importance of strong cash flow. Properties that generate positive monthly income provide a safety net during downturns, allowing you to hold through recessions without being forced to sell at a loss. They give you the financial stability to be patient and strategic when others are desperate.
